WG1 Strategic port development projects (ITMMA)
 
File: WG1 Strategic port development projects (ITMMA).pdf (Size: 632.98 kb)
 
The working paper addresses how inland ports and barge terminals in seaports can contribute to the growth of inland navigation in the future. Three issues are investigated: (1) Operational transhipment performance, (2) Quality of hinterland connections and (3) Capacity: few expansion opportunities versus overcapacity.
The working paper gives a brief statistical overview of barge freight transport in the EU-25 Member States. It provides an overview of Europe’s inland waterway policy and discusses national transport policies to promote inland navigation for selected countries where inland navigation plays an important role. The paper focuses on the port-related bottlenecks with which inland navigation and inland ports in Europe are currently confronted. Finally, it contains policy recommendations.
